Falling in love Quote by Chessela Helm

“He knew it was stupid to say he was falling in love with her. They had only known each other for a week. But he was definitely losing rational thought because of her. He was feeling emotions that were new and intoxicating. Maybe it wasn’t love, but it was definitely something.” quote by Chessela Helm
